To predict the probable immune response of the designed multi-epitope vaccine construct in human immune system, in silico immune simulations were conducted using the C-ImmSim server (http://150.146.2.1/C-IMMSIM/index.php) (Rapin et al., 2010) . C-ImmSim is a novel in silico approach for the study of the mammalian immune system The tool is a combination of a mesoscopic scale simulator of the immune system with machine learning techniques for molecular-level predictions of major histocompatibility complex (MHC)-peptide-binding interactions, linear B-cell epitope discovery, and protein-protein potential estimation.
